Definition

Broad, wide, and spacious.

neutraldescriptionsplaces

How it's used

Describes physical spaces that feel expansive or unobstructed, often implying a sense of freedom or grand scale. While it functions as a formal adjective, it is perfectly acceptable in daily speech when emphasizing the vastness of an area. It is more commonly used for outdoor environments like roads, plazas, or landscapes rather than small indoor rooms.

Common mistake

Avoid using this to describe small objects or narrow items, as it specifically conveys a sense of large, open breadth. For everyday indoor spaces or furniture, native speakers often prefer using 闊 or 大 instead.
